Copper Hourglass Sleeve

Extruded copper hourglass sleeves and stop buttons are designed for efficient cold forming and secure, non-rusting permanent splices. Made from 99% pure copper, these sleeves and buttons offer exceptional holding strength due to their mass.

Return eye splices using copper hourglass sleeves can achieve 95% of the Improved Plow wire rope catalog strength when properly swaged.

Important: To ensure optimal strength and safety, return eye slings using copper hourglass sleeves must be swaged correctly.

Aluminum Hourglass Sleeve

Extruded Aluminum hourglass sleeves and stop buttons are made from a high-strength aluminum alloy and heat-treated for superior cold-forming and swaging properties.

Return eye splices using aluminum hourglass sleeves can achieve 95% of the Improved Plow wire rope catalogue strength when properly swaged.

Important: To ensure optimal strength and safety, return eye slings using aluminum hourglass sleeves must be swaged correctly.

Sleeves from other manufacturers may have slightly different dimensions. While the core dimensions like inner diameter and outer diameter might be similar, there can be variations in:

  • Wall thickness: Some manufacturers may produce sleeves with slightly thicker or thinner walls.
  • Compression ratio: The amount a sleeve compresses when crimped can vary between manufacturers, impacting the final dimensions.
  • Tolerances: Manufacturing tolerances can lead to small variations in dimensions even for the same product.

It’s essential to consult the specific manufacturer’s specifications for the most accurate dimensions and compatibility information. This will help ensure that the sleeves you choose are compatible with your crimping tool and provide the desired holding strength for your application.

The swaging or clamping process compresses the rope, which causes a slight loss of strength. The termination efficiency for a copper button stop is 33%–50% if it’s properly swaged. Aluminum button stops are not recommended for use with stainless steel cable.

Efficiency ratings for rope fittings are determined by comparing the actual breaking strength of the rope to the breaking strength achieved with the fitting. While spelter sockets can reach 100% efficiency when properly applied, most other fittings are swaged or clamped onto the rope.

This process compresses the rope, leading to a slight reduction in strength. Some references may claim 100% efficiency for swaged sockets, but it’s important to note that many wire ropes have an actual breaking strength that’s 5-15% higher than the cataloged strength.

Therefore, a fitting with a 90% efficiency rating can still achieve the cataloged breaking strength of the rope due to the rope’s higher actual breaking strength.
